Our home suffered damage due to Hurricane ***. We filed a claim with the insurance company and proceeded to get a quote for a roof replacement with a local roofer. This roofer gave us a recommendation for an adjuster should we consider working with one. After the insurance company came back with a settlement we were less than satisfied with, we contacted said adjuster who promised us the world. In the end, all we got was a headache, hurt feelings and a hole in our roof. The adjuster did not stay in contact with updates. Months into the process, our insurance company entered bankruptcy with no chance for us to recover any monies. We had to pay for our repairs out of pocket for if not we'd be entering the rainy season with a very damaged roof. We have done all of the leg work and have asked the company for release from the expired contract. The adjusters' response to the request was rude and threatening. We have no interest in doing any business with Five Star Adjusters.Customer response

To whom it may concern, Following Hurricane ******** hired Five Star claims public adjuster to do a job I was not sure how to handle. It started out well the process was moving forward with little to no issues. Mid November I was issued a check from ******************** for$34,000 it had my name and five Star claims on the check. Because Five Star Claims was the first name on the check it was mailed to them endorsed by them and then cashed without my endorsement. They deny any wrong doing on the improper handling of my claims check. After this occurred it felt like Five Star Claims stopped advocating on my behalf with ********************. My Fianc and I frustrated with the lack of support from Five Star claims, decided to handle the claim and make headway on our claim. Since December my fianc and I have been handling the claim because we have no trust in Five Star to do right by us anymore. With the amount of money that goes through their hands they should have protocols and procedures and security measures to prevent the loss and theft of endorsed checks. I feel the lack of attention to my claim requiring me to do all the leg work I hired them to do is enough for me to have this contract voided. ******************** claims adjuster *************************** and her supervisor ********************* can confirm that most negotiations on the settlement happened because my fianc and I took matters into our own hands. On Monday May 15th 2023 I sent my fianc with a check for about $64,000 to five Star claims almost 3 hrs away from our home to get endorsed to find out we needed a check for their commission. After confirming with *********************** that I would be allowed to mail the check next day priority I did so in a rush to mail a check for $6400 took pictures of the check receipt and tracking number. Just to be told after spending $45 on priority mail I cant do that so instead of waiting a day for the check they canceled the endorsement. Setting me back months now to get this resolved.Business response
